Bolted Tension Clamps Must Be Tightened To The Specified Torque Value

Proper installation of a bolt-type tension clamp requires calibrated torque wrenches to apply exact manufacturer torque specifications. This precise tightening prevents conductor slippage, eliminates excessive mechanical stress, and maintains stable electrical conductivity across high-voltage overhead distribution lines.

Preparation and Conductor Positioning

Line crews clean conductor surfaces with wire brushes to remove oxide layers before positioning hardware. Placing the conductor into the bolted type strain clamp groove ensures uniform contact along the entire gripping surface without damaging individual aluminum strands.

Installation Sequence

  1. Aligning a dead end strain clamp requires manual thread engagement prior to mechanical tightening. Installers seat U-bolts or straight bolts evenly to prevent tilting the pressure plate, which causes localized stress points during tensioning.

  2. Operators set torque wrench indicators to match engineering drawings. Applying force incrementally across diagonal bolt patterns guarantees balanced clamping force. This systematic procedure stops conductor deformation while securing high mechanical tension loads.

Quality Control and Torque Verification

Final inspection demands verifying every fastener on the bolted dead end clamp with a calibrated click-type torque wrench. Marking torqued bolt heads with paint provides immediate visual confirmation that installation standards have been fully satisfied.

Recommended Torque Specifications

Standard torque values depend directly on bolt diameter and steel grade. Following recommended torque settings prevents thread stripping and guarantees optimal retention force under outdoor environmental conditions.

Bolt Diameter Thread Pitch Torque Rating (Nm) Torque Rating (ft-lb)
M10 Standard 35 – 40 26 – 30
M12 Standard 60 – 65 44 – 48
M16 Standard 135 – 145 100 – 107
